Building A Sustainable Online Business

Today’s topic will be about how you can and should build a sustainable online business for yourself. This is a mistake which i think many Internet Marketers have committed including myself. The concept of what’s a online business was wrong right from the start.

Therefore, if you are reading this and you are just being to get your feet wet with Internet Marketing, then make sure you read this post carefully because this will affect how you build your online empire forever! If you are able an experience marketer, then maybe this post might change your concept a little..

For me, building a business used to be earning as much money as possible in the shortest amount of time. If i want to hit $10,000 in profit a month, i would simply focus on what i am good at and build my income upwards. For example, i used to be pretty good in Adwords… So Adwords was all my focus… Adwords was all i did all day and i got pretty successful at it. I manage to build a 5 figure income quickly with Adwords and i was satisfied with my achievement. I thought i had build and established my online business.

But i was wrong… in fact dead wrong… One fine day the Google slap came along and BAM… 90% of my income was lost… Lucky this happened to me when i had no liability yet.. No family, no expenses, no bills, no installment, no car, no houses.. Imagine if it happen to you when you had all the bills to pay and your family to feed.. Its gonna be a darn hard blow..

The lesson i learnt was that i was building my house (business) straight up.. I build a thin house with only one pillar supporting the entireĀ  roof. When the pillar toppled, the whole house collapsed. In reality, nobody builds a house upwards in a straight line.

The same applied for online business. We need to build many pillars to support the roof and make the base as wide as possible so that we are covered from all angles. Even if one pillar topples, the roof would not collapse completely and there’s still time to mend the house..

The more pillars you have for your house, the more wide the base is, the stronger and steadier your house would be. No doubt, it would take a much longer time and definitely much more effort to reach your target income.. but think about it.. Would you want a business that can last or would you want a business that come and go equally fast?

I learnt the lesson of building my house straight up and the house eventually collapse and now i’m starting to build my house again. But this time i’m taking more time to build a solid and wide base with as many pillars as possible before moving up to the roof..

This pillars i am talking about is Traffic Sources. The more traffic sources you have in your business bringing you income, the more stable your business will be. Even if one pillar breaks, you still have many others to tide you over. I’m really starting to see this concept after 2 years of being in this business.
